1 Mbit 128Kb x8, Uniform Block Low Voltage Single Supply Flash Memory # Technical Documentation: M29W010B55K1 1-Mbit (128K x 8) Flash Memory
 Manufacturer : STMicroelectronics
 Document Version : 1.0
 Date : October 26, 2023
---
## 1. Application Scenarios
The M29W010B55K1 is a 1-Megabit (128K x 8) CMOS Flash memory device, fabricated using ST's proprietary SuperFlash® technology. It is a 5V-only, single-supply device designed for applications requiring non-volatile, in-system programmable memory with moderate density and high reliability.
### Typical Use Cases
*    Firmware Storage : Primarily used for storing boot code, application firmware, and configuration parameters in embedded systems. Its 55ns access time makes it suitable for systems where the CPU fetches code directly from the Flash (XIP - Execute In Place) without requiring shadowing in RAM.
*    Parameter and Data Logging : Used to store calibration data, device settings, user preferences, and event logs in industrial controllers, medical devices, and automotive subsystems. The sector architecture allows for efficient update of small data blocks.
*    Programmable Logic Configuration : Stores configuration bitstreams for CPLDs (Complex Programmable Logic Devices) or smaller FPGAs in systems where the configuration device must be in-system programmable.
*    Code Shadowing/Overlay : In systems with limited RAM, critical routines can be copied from this Flash into higher-speed SRAM for execution, leveraging its fast read performance.
### Industry Applications
*    Industrial Automation : PLCs (Programmable Logic Controllers), sensor interfaces, motor drives, and HMI (Human-Machine Interface) panels for storing control algorithms and operational parameters.
*    Consumer Electronics : Set-top boxes, printers, networking equipment (routers, switches), and home automation controllers.
*    Automotive (Non-Critical) : Body control modules, infotainment systems (for non-safety critical data), and aftermarket accessories.  Note : This specific component is not typically AEC-Q100 qualified; automotive-grade variants should be sourced for qualified designs.
*    Telecommunications : Line cards, base station controllers, and network management cards for storing boot code and firmware.
*    Legacy System Maintenance : A common choice for servicing and upgrading older industrial and communications equipment originally designed with 5V-only, parallel Flash memories.
### Practical Advantages and Limitations
 Advantages: 
*    Single 5V Supply : Simplifies power supply design compared to devices requiring 12V for programming.
*    Low Power Consumption : CMOS technology offers low active and standby currents, beneficial for power-sensitive applications.
*    High Reliability : Endurance of 100,000 program/erase cycles per sector and data retention of 20 years ensure long-term data integrity.
*    Standard Pinout and Command Set : JEDEC-compatible pinout and command set improve second-source availability and ease software driver porting.
*    Sector Erase Architecture : Two 16 Kbyte boot blocks (top or bottom configurable), one 8 Kbyte parameter block, and one main 96 Kbyte block allow flexible protection of critical code.
 Limitations: 
*    Parallel Interface : Consumes more PCB traces and microcontroller I/O pins compared to serial (SPI) Flash memories, increasing system interconnect complexity.
*    Moderate Density : 1 Mbit density is low for modern multimedia or complex operating system storage but remains adequate for many bare-metal and RTOS-based embedded applications.
*    Speed Relative to Modern Parts : While 55ns is fast for its class, it is slower than contemporary synchronous or DDR Flash interfaces used in high-performance computing.
*    Footprint : TSOP48 package, while standard, is larger than more modern